Avient Corporation announced it has achieved a Gold Level rating from EcoVadis, a globally recognized sustainability ratings platform. This recognition highlights Avient's commitment to sustainability, ethics, and responsible business practices.
Avient placed in the 94th percentile, or top 6 percent, of the more than 100,000 companies assessed by EcoVadis. The methodology covers performance across a comprehensive range of 21 performance indicators in four themes: environmental, labor and human rights, ethics, and sustainable procurement.
